Transaction 9781c653a2360f9882e35c52ac116e6899512db363a131bd3d3b0a7216648092
1 Input
1 Output
-
9781c653a2360f9882e35c52ac116e6899512db363a131bd3d3b0a7216648092: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 864c7aa10489a579d852a929675ad90693922b22060b0b65aaa79f939c072f87
- address
- bc1psex84ggy3xjhnkzj4y5kwkkeq6fey2ezqc9sked2570e88q897rsrmewhv